00 00 00 1 00 – 7F Master Volume 0 – 127 MIDI Master
Volume
01 1 28 – 58 Master Note Shift -24 – +24 [semitones]
02 4 00 – 0F
00 – 0F
00 – 0F
00 – 0F
Master Tune -102.4 – +102.3 [cent]
1st bit3-0 bit15-12
2nd bit3-0 bit11-8
3rd bit3-0 bit7-4
4th bit3-0 bit3-0
MIDI Master
Tuning
06 1 00 – 01 Controller Reset hold, reset
07 1 35 – 4B Master Transpose -11 – +11 (semitones)
08 1 3D – 43 Master Octave Shift -3 – +3
09 1 00 – 01 Local Switch off, on
0A 1 00 – 10, 7F Basic Receive Channel 1 – 16, omni, off
0B 1 00 – 0F, 7F Keyboard Transmit Channel 1 – 16, off
0C 1 reserved
0D 1 reserved
0E 1 00 – 01 Stereo L&R Output Gain 00: 0dB, 01: +6dB
0F 1 00 – 01 Assignable Output L&R Gain 00: 0dB, 01: +6dB
10 1 00 – 7F Individual Output Gain bit0: 0, +6dB 1&2,
bit1: 0, +6dB 3&4, ...,
bit6: 0, +6dB 13&14
11 1 00 – 03 BC Curve (for TG) thru, soft, hard, wide
12 1 00 – 04 Keyboard Velocity Curve norm, soft, hard, wide,
fixed
13 1 01 – 7F Keyboard Fixed Velocity 1 – 127
14 1 00 – 01 Receive GM/XG On for Multi
Part PB
off, on
15 1 00 – 01 Receive/Transmit Bank Select off, on
16 1 00 – 01 Receive/Transmit Program
Change
off, on
17 1 00 – 01 MIDI Control Mode mode1, mode2
18 1 00 – 07 Thru Port for USB/mLAN 1 – 8
19 1 00 – 02 MIDI IN/OUT MIDI, USB, mLAN
1A 1 00 – 03 Effect Bypass for System
Effect
bit0: Reverb,
bit1: Chorus
1B 1 00 – 01 Effect Bypass for Master
Effect
off, on
1C 1 00 – 03 Effect Bypass for Insertion
Effect
bit0: Internal,
bit1: Plug-in Board
1D 1 reserved
1E 1 00 – 01 AutoLoad Switch off, on
1F 1 00 – 06 Power on Mode Performance, Voice
(INT), Voice (PRE1),
GM, last, Master, Multi
20 1 reserved
21 1 00 – 02 Single Part Plug-in Board Port
Assign for Multi Mode
1, 2, 3 Port 1 in any
other mode
22 1 00 – 02 Multi Part Plug-in Board Port
Assign for Multi Mode
1, 2, 3 Port 1 in any
other mode
23 1 reserved
24 1 reserved
25 1 00 – 01 Analog Input Gain mic, line
26 1 reserved
27 1 reserved
28 1 reserved
29 1 00 – 01 mLAN Monitor Switch off, on
2A 1 00 – 55 Assign A Destination off, 1 – 85
2B 1 00 – 55 Assign B Destination off, 1 – 85
2C 1 reserved
2D 1 00 – 5F Assign A Control Number off, 1 – 95
2E 1 00 – 5F Assign B Control Number off, 1 – 95
2F 1 reserved
30 1 00 – 5F RB Control Number off, 1 – 95 for Voice Mode
31 1 00 – 65 FS Assign off, 1 – 95, ArpSw,
ArpHold, Play/Stop,
PCInc, PCDec,
OctaveReset
32 1 00 – 5F ARP Switch Control Number off,1 – 95
33 1 00 – 5F ARP Hold Control Number off,1 – 95
34 1 00 – 01 ARP MIDI Out Switch off, on for Voice Mode
35 1 00 – 0F ARP MIDI Out Channel 1 – 16 :
36 1 00 – 5F Assign1 Control Number off, 1 – 95 :
37 1 00 – 5F Assign2 Control Number off, 1 – 95 :
38 1 00 – 5F BC Control Number off, 1 – 95 :
39 1 00 – 5F FC2 Control Number off, 1 – 95 :
3A 1 00 – 5F FC1 Control Number off, 1 – 95
3B 1 00 – 02 Sustain Pedal Select FC3 (Half on),
FC3 (Half off), FC4/5
